Abstract

A coconut methyl ester torch fuel is dis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A torch fuel comprising a methyl ester having a carbon chain length distribution of less than 20 percent by weight C8 and C10 constituents, at least 74 percent by weight of constituents of carbon chain lengths in excess of C10, and an amount of ancillary constituents. 
     
     
         2 . The torch fuel of  claim 1 , wherein the methyl ester comprises from 8-10 percent by weight C8 constituents and from 6-9 percent by weight C10 constituents. 
     
     
         3 . The torch fuel of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 46-52 percent by weight C12 constituents;   15-19 percent by weight C14 constituents;   7-10 percent by weight C16 constituents; and   6-9 percent by weight C18 constituents.   
     
     
         4 . The torch fuel of  claim 3 , further comprising amount of C6 constituents that is less than 2 percent by weight of the methyl ester. 
     
     
         5 . The torch fuel of  claim 3 , wherein the methyl ester is a coconut methyl ester. 
     
     
         6 . A torch comprising:
 a fuel canister;   a wick;   a wick holder that supports the wick for burning and to draw fuel from the canister; and   a torch fuel comprising a methyl ester that has C8 and C10 carbon chain constituents ranging from 14-20 percent of a total weight of methyl ester and at least 74 percent total weight longer carbon chain constituents.   
     
     
         7 . The torch of  claim 6 , wherein the methyl ester further comprises:
 46-52 percent by weight C12 constituents;   15-19 percent by weight C14 constituents;   7-10 percent by weight C16 constituents;   6-9 percent by weight C18 constituents; and   2 percent or less by weight C6 constituents.   
     
     
         8 . The torch of  claim 6 , wherein the methyl ester comprises from 8-11 percent by weight C8 constituents. 
     
     
         9 . The torch of  claim 6 , wherein the methyl ester comprises from 6-9 percent by weight C10 constituents. 
     
     
         10 . The torch of  claim 7 , wherein the methyl ester is a coconut methyl ester. 
     
     
         11 . A method comprising:
 providing a fuel canister;   providing a wick;   providing a wick holder that supports the wick for burning and for drawing fuel from the canister; and   providing a fuel in the fuel container that is drawn into and burned on the wick;   wherein the fuel comprises a methyl ester having 14-20 percent by weight C8 and C10 carbon chain constituents and at least 74 percent by weight C12 and longer carbon chain constituents.   
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ein the fuel comprises coconut methyl esters.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the fuel further comprises:
 46-52 percent by weight C12;   15-19 percent by weight C14;   7-10 percent by weight C16;   6-9 percent by weight C18; and   2 percent or less by weight C6.   
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the fuel comprises from 8-11 percent by weight C8.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the fuel comprises from 6-9 percent by weight C10.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 13 , wherein the fuel comprises from 8-11 percent by weight C8 and from 6-9 percent C10.
